Emotional pain

Emotional pain can be caused by a variety of factors, including:

  • Trauma: Trauma is an experience that is so overwhelming that the body and mind cannot process it in a healthy way. Trauma can be caused by events such as abuse, neglect, war, or violence.
  • Stress: Stress is a natural response of the body to threats or challenges. However, chronic stress can cause emotional and physical damage.
  • Anxiety: Anxiety is a state of restlessness or worry. It can be caused by a variety of factors, including stress, trauma or genetics.
  • Depression: Depression is a mood disorder characterized by feelings of sadness, apathy, and loss of interest.

What is emotional healing?

Emotional healing is the process of healing past pain and suffering. It is a process that can help you find peace and fulfillment in the present. Emotional release is a key step to achieve it

Emotional healing can be a long and challenging process, but it can also be very rewarding. The emotional healing process may include:

  • Acceptance: The first step to emotional healing is accepting what happened. This doesn't mean you have to agree with what happened, but simply acknowledge it as a part of your story.
  • Forgiveness: Forgiveness is a process of releasing anger, resentment and hatred towards the person or situation that caused you pain. Forgiveness doesn't mean you forget what happened, it simply means you stop allowing the pain of the past to control your present.
  • Compassion: Compassion is the ability to feel empathy and understanding for others. When you develop compassion, you can begin to see yourself and others with more understanding and acceptance.
  • Personal growth: Emotional healing can be an opportunity to grow personally. Through the healing process, you can learn more about yourself, your strengths and your weaknesses.

How to heal emotional wounds?

Emotional wounds are the effects of the pain and suffering we have experienced in our lives. They can be caused by traumatic events, such as abuse, abandonment, or loss.

Emotional wounds can manifest in different ways, such as anxiety, depression, low self-esteem or relationship problems.

The emotional healing process can be long and challenging, but it is possible. Some of the things we can do to heal our emotional wounds include:

  • Recognize and accept our wounds: The first step to healing is to recognize and accept our wounds. This can be difficult, but it is necessary in order to begin working on your healing.
  • Express our emotions: It is important to express our emotions in a healthy and constructive way. This can be done through therapy, writing, art, or any other way that works for us.
  • Forgive: Forgiveness is a complex process, but it can be very liberating. Forgiveness does not mean forgetting what happened, but rather stopping harboring resentment or resentment towards the person who hurt us.
  • Take care of ourselves: It is important to take care of ourselves and attend to our basic needs. This includes taking care of our physical, mental and emotional health.
